ASP.NET Excel Export formatting question
Posted
by BWC
on Stack Overflow
See other posts from Stack Overflow
or by BWC
Published on 2010-03-08T22:45:25Z
Indexed on
2010/03/09
0:36 UTC
Read the original article
Hit count: 330
Hey Guys,
I've been banging my head on the wall over this issue for a couple days now and I need some help.
I'm creating an excel file using ASP.net and everything is going just fine except one column has to be formatted as a decimal to 2 places but when it pulls into excel, excel automatically formats it as a whole number instead of keeping the decimal places.
sw.Write(String.Format("{0:f}", CDbl(dr(14)).ToString("0.00")))
this produces "20.00"
but when I open it in excel it's displayed as 20...if I select the whole column and format it as a number it gets displayed as 20.00 like it's supposed to but I don't want to have to do this (I can't do that) the file is supposed to be automatically picked up and imported into another system that needs the column to be a decimal.
Any suggestions would be greatly appreciated.
© Stack Overflow or respective owner